uHoo features and specs

  • Comprehensive Monitoring
    uHoo offers real-time monitoring of nine different environmental parameters, including temperature, humidity, dust, VOCs, and more, providing users with a holistic view of their indoor air quality.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The device is equipped with an intuitive app interface that allows for easy access to data and insights, enabling users to quickly understand their indoor air quality status.
  • Smart Home Integration
    uHoo integrates with popular smart home systems such as Alexa and Google Assistant, allowing for seamless control and automation of your indoor environment.
  • Data Analytics
    The system provides detailed analytics and trends over time, enabling users to track changes in air quality and make informed decisions to improve it.
  • Alerts and Notifications
    Users receive instant notifications and alerts when air quality levels change or exceed certain thresholds, ensuring that they can take prompt action to address any issues.

Climate Finder features and specs

  • Comprehensive Data
    Climate Finder provides extensive climate information, including temperature and precipitation data across different regions, making it useful for detailed climate analysis.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The platform is designed with a user-friendly interface that allows users to easily navigate and find climate data relevant to their interests or research.
  • Custom Search Features
    Climate Finder offers custom search capabilities, enabling users to specify parameters according to their specific climate requirements or preferences.
  • Interactive Visualization
    The website features interactive maps and graphics which help users visualize climate data more effectively, enhancing the understanding of climate trends and anomalies.
